About Daffodl

The artwork, entitled “Daffodil,” was created in 1913 by Louis Comfort Tiffany, a prominent artist associated with the Art Nouveau (Modern) movement. This particular piece falls within the genre of design and belongs to the series famously known as Tiffany lampshades.

The artwork captures the elegance and intricate craftsmanship characteristic of Tiffany’s creations. Featuring a lampshade adorned with vibrant yellow daffodils set against a background of lush green stems and rich blue sky, the composition beautifully exemplifies the Art Nouveau style. The leaded glass technique used in crafting the shade allows light to filter through the colorful tessellated design, creating a mesmerizing interplay of color and light. The lamp is supported by a richly detailed bronze base, adding to its ornamental appeal. This piece stands as a testament to Tiffany’s enduring legacy in the world of decorative arts and design.
